<title>Mechanical changes to package PLISTs to make use of LIBTOOLIZE_PLIST.</title>

All library names listed by *.la files no longer need to be listed
in the PLIST, e.g., instead of:

	lib/libfoo.a
	lib/libfoo.la
	lib/libfoo.so
	lib/libfoo.so.0
	lib/libfoo.so.0.1

one simply needs:

	lib/libfoo.la

and bsd.pkg.mk will automatically ensure that the additional library
names are listed in the installed package +CONTENTS file.

Also make LIBTOOLIZE_PLIST default to "yes".

libol is a library written by the author of syslog-ng, Balazs
Scheidler, which is used in syslog-ng.  A built copy of libol needs to
be present on a system when syslog-ng is built.
